Michael Kane

   Michael “Max” James Kane, 44, of Gladwin passed away from a sudden illness on Sept. 8, 2006 at his home. Michael was born Feb. 4, 1962 to James and Terry (Dixon) Kane in Royal Oak.

   Michael was a salesman for the telecommunications industry. He lived in Gladwin for five years. He previously resided in Austin, Texas.

   Michael is survived by his parents, James and Terry Kane of Gladwin; two sisters, Lisa (Bruce) Low of Ann Arbor, and Colleen (Paul) Jorgensen of Fenton; one brother, Dixon (Beth) Kane of Ann Arbor; nieces and nephews, Jennifer, Evan, and Erica Jorgensen, Chelsea and Gram Low, and Harrison Kane; grandmother, Audrey Dixon of Palm City, Florida; and his cat, Harold.

   Memorial services will be held Wednesday, Sept. 13, 2006 at 2 p.m. at Hall Funeral Home in Gladwin.
